Business

“crm software for small business: Top 7 CRM Software for Small Business: Ultimate Power Guide

Running a small business? You need the right tools. Discover the most powerful CRM software for small business that boosts sales, streamlines communication, and scales with your growth—all without breaking the bank.

Why CRM Software for Small Business Is a Game-Changer

Modern CRM dashboard interface showing customer data, sales pipeline, and analytics for small business
Image: Modern CRM dashboard interface showing customer data, sales pipeline, and analytics for small business

Small businesses often operate with limited resources, tight budgets, and high expectations. In this competitive landscape, customer relationships are everything. That’s where CRM software for small business comes in—not as a luxury, but as a necessity. A well-chosen Customer Relationship Management (CRM) system helps you organize leads, track interactions, automate follow-ups, and deliver personalized experiences at scale.

What Is CRM Software?

CRM stands for Customer Relationship Management. At its core, CRM software is a centralized platform where businesses store and manage all customer-related data—contact details, purchase history, communication logs, support tickets, and more. It’s like a digital Rolodex on steroids, designed to help you understand your customers better and serve them more effectively.

  • Tracks every customer interaction across email, phone, social media, and live chat.
  • Automates repetitive tasks like follow-up emails and appointment scheduling.
  • Provides insights through analytics and reporting tools.

For small businesses, this means less time spent on manual data entry and more time building real relationships.

Why Small Businesses Need CRM

Many small business owners still rely on spreadsheets, sticky notes, or memory to manage customer data. While this might work in the early stages, it quickly becomes unsustainable. As your customer base grows, so does the risk of missed opportunities, duplicated efforts, and poor customer service.

“A small business that doesn’t use CRM is like a ship without a compass—drifting, not driving.”

CRM software for small business eliminates chaos by providing structure. It ensures that every lead is followed up, every support ticket is tracked, and every sales opportunity is nurtured. According to a study by Nucleus Research, every dollar invested in CRM returns an average of $8.71 in return—making it one of the most cost-effective tools available.

Moreover, CRM systems help small businesses compete with larger enterprises. With the right CRM, a five-person team can deliver a customer experience that rivals that of a Fortune 500 company.

Top 7 CRM Software for Small Business in 2024

Choosing the right CRM software for small business can feel overwhelming. There are dozens of options, each with different features, pricing models, and learning curves. To simplify your decision, we’ve analyzed the top seven CRM platforms based on usability, affordability, scalability, and customer support.

1. HubSpot CRM

HubSpot CRM is often hailed as the best free CRM for small businesses. It offers a robust set of features at no cost, making it ideal for startups and growing companies.

  • Free Forever Plan: Includes contact management, email tracking, deal pipelines, and live chat.
  • Integrations: Seamlessly connects with Gmail, Outlook, Slack, and over 1,000 apps via HubSpot Marketplace.
  • User-Friendly Interface: Known for its intuitive design and easy onboarding.

While the free version is powerful, HubSpot also offers paid tiers (Sales Hub, Service Hub) for businesses that need advanced automation, reporting, and team collaboration tools. One standout feature is the timeline view, which shows every interaction a contact has had with your business in chronological order.

HubSpot’s educational resources, including free courses and certifications, make it a favorite among small business owners who want to grow their marketing and sales skills alongside their CRM.

2. Zoho CRM

Zoho CRM is a feature-rich platform that combines affordability with enterprise-level functionality. It’s particularly popular among small businesses in sales, real estate, and professional services.

  • AI-Powered Assistant (Zia): Predicts deal closures, suggests next steps, and automates data entry.
  • Customizable Sales Funnels: Allows businesses to tailor pipelines to their unique sales process.
  • Multi-Channel Communication: Integrates email, phone, social media, and web forms into one dashboard.

Zoho CRM starts at $14/user/month and offers a 15-day free trial. It’s part of the larger Zoho ecosystem, which includes tools for accounting, project management, and HR—making it a great choice for businesses looking to consolidate their software stack.

One of its most powerful features is Zia Voice, which allows sales reps to log calls and update records using voice commands. This is a huge time-saver for teams on the go.

3. Salesforce Essentials

Salesforce is the world’s leading CRM platform, and Salesforce Essentials is its entry-level product designed specifically for small businesses with up to 10 users.

  • Mobile-First Design: Optimized for smartphones and tablets, perfect for remote or field-based teams.
  • Pre-Built Templates: Comes with industry-specific workflows for real estate, consulting, and retail.
  • Strong Integration Ecosystem: Connects with G Suite, Mailchimp, DocuSign, and more.

Priced at $25/user/month, Salesforce Essentials offers a taste of the full Salesforce power without the complexity. It includes lead and opportunity management, email integration, and basic reporting.

While it’s more expensive than some competitors, the investment pays off in scalability. If your business grows, you can easily upgrade to Salesforce Professional or Enterprise editions without switching platforms.

4. Freshsales (by Freshworks)

Freshsales is a modern CRM built for sales teams that want speed and simplicity. It’s known for its clean interface and smart automation features.

  • Visual Deal Pipeline: Drag-and-drop interface makes it easy to move deals through stages.
  • AI-Based Lead Scoring: Automatically ranks leads based on behavior and engagement.
  • Built-In Calling and Email: Make calls and send emails directly from the CRM.

Freshsales starts at $15/user/month and offers a free version for up to three users. Its Gong-like conversation intelligence feature records and analyzes sales calls to improve performance.

One of the biggest advantages of Freshsales is its speed. The platform loads quickly, even on older devices, and the setup process takes less than 15 minutes. This makes it ideal for small businesses that need to get up and running fast.

5. Insightly

Insightly is a CRM and project management hybrid, making it perfect for small businesses that manage client projects, such as marketing agencies, consultants, and contractors.

  • Project & Task Management: Link CRM records to tasks, milestones, and deadlines.
  • Workflow Automation: Automate follow-ups, reminders, and data updates.
  • Customer Journey Tracking: Visualize the entire lifecycle from lead to repeat customer.

Priced from $29/user/month, Insightly is on the higher end of the spectrum, but the added project management features justify the cost for service-based businesses.

Its relationship linking feature allows you to map connections between contacts, organizations, and opportunities—helping you uncover hidden sales potential.

6. Pipedrive

Pipedrive is a sales-focused CRM that emphasizes pipeline management. It’s designed for small sales teams that want to visualize their deals and close more deals.

  • Drag-and-Drop Pipeline: Intuitive interface that makes sales forecasting easy.
  • Activity Reminders: Schedule calls, emails, and tasks with automatic reminders.
  • Mobile App: Full functionality on iOS and Android devices.

Pipedrive starts at $14.90/user/month and offers a 14-day free trial. It’s particularly popular among real estate agents, freelancers, and B2B sales teams.

One of its standout features is the Smart Contact Data, which automatically enriches contact profiles with company details, social media links, and job titles.

Pipedrive also integrates with over 400 tools, including Mailchimp, Slack, and QuickBooks, making it easy to connect with your existing tech stack.

7. Agile CRM

Agile CRM combines CRM, marketing automation, and helpdesk functionality into one affordable package. It’s a great all-in-one solution for small businesses that want to manage sales, marketing, and support in a single platform.

  • Marketing Automation: Create email campaigns, landing pages, and web tracking.
  • Helpdesk Ticketing: Manage customer support requests directly in the CRM.
  • Free Plan Available: Up to 10 users with basic CRM features.

Priced from $9.99/user/month, Agile CRM is one of the most budget-friendly options on this list. However, some users report that the interface feels cluttered compared to more modern CRMs.

Despite this, its web tracking and lead scoring features are powerful for businesses focused on digital marketing and lead generation.

Key Features to Look for in CRM Software for Small Business

Not all CRM systems are created equal. When evaluating CRM software for small business, focus on features that align with your goals, team size, and budget. Here are the most important ones to consider:

1. Contact & Lead Management

The foundation of any CRM is its ability to store and organize customer data. Look for a system that allows you to:

  • Import contacts from email, spreadsheets, or social media.
  • Tag and segment contacts by industry, location, or behavior.
  • Track communication history (emails, calls, meetings).

A good CRM should make it easy to find any customer’s information in seconds, reducing response times and improving service quality.

2. Sales Pipeline & Automation

Your sales process should be visual and repeatable. A CRM with a customizable sales pipeline lets you map out each stage—from lead capture to closing—and track progress in real time.

Automation features like email sequences, task reminders, and follow-up triggers help reduce manual work and ensure no lead falls through the cracks.

“Automation doesn’t replace humans—it frees them to do more meaningful work.”

For example, when a lead downloads a whitepaper, the CRM can automatically add them to a nurture sequence, assign a follow-up task to a sales rep, and update their lead score.

3. Mobile Accessibility

Small business owners are rarely at a desk. Whether you’re meeting clients, attending events, or working remotely, you need access to your CRM on the go.

Look for platforms with robust mobile apps that offer full functionality—contact lookup, note-taking, calling, and deal updates—without requiring a laptop.

Both HubSpot and Salesforce offer excellent mobile experiences, with offline access and voice-to-text capabilities.

How to Choose the Right CRM Software for Small Business

Selecting the right CRM isn’t just about features—it’s about fit. A tool that works for a tech startup might not suit a local bakery. Here’s a step-by-step guide to help you make the best choice.

1. Define Your Goals

Ask yourself: What do you want to achieve with a CRM?

  • Improve customer service?
  • Close more sales?
  • Automate marketing campaigns?
  • Manage client projects?

Your primary goal will determine which CRM features matter most. For example, if you run a service-based business, project management integration (like Insightly) might be more valuable than advanced sales forecasting.

2. Assess Your Team’s Needs

Consider how your team works. Do they prefer simplicity or advanced customization? Are they tech-savvy or do they need hand-holding?

A user-friendly CRM like HubSpot or Pipedrive is ideal for teams with limited technical experience. On the other hand, Zoho CRM offers deep customization for teams that want to tailor every workflow.

Also, think about adoption. Even the best CRM fails if your team doesn’t use it. Choose a platform with good onboarding, training resources, and responsive support.

3. Evaluate Integration Capabilities

Your CRM shouldn’t exist in a vacuum. It needs to connect with your email, calendar, accounting software, and marketing tools.

Check if the CRM integrates with:

  • Email platforms (Gmail, Outlook)
  • Accounting software (QuickBooks, Xero)
  • Marketing tools (Mailchimp, Facebook Ads)
  • Phone systems (RingCentral, Zoom)

Most modern CRMs offer native integrations or support Zapier for custom connections.

Common Mistakes When Implementing CRM Software for Small Business

Even with the best CRM, poor implementation can lead to failure. Here are the most common pitfalls and how to avoid them.

1. Not Training the Team

One of the biggest reasons CRM projects fail is lack of training. Employees won’t use a tool they don’t understand.

Solution: Dedicate time for onboarding. Use vendor-provided tutorials, host internal workshops, and appoint a CRM champion to answer questions.

2. Poor Data Migration

Moving data from spreadsheets or old systems can be messy. Duplicate entries, missing fields, and incorrect formatting can ruin your CRM’s effectiveness.

Solution: Clean your data before importing. Remove duplicates, standardize formats (e.g., phone numbers, addresses), and test with a small batch first.

3. Over-Customizing Too Soon

It’s tempting to tweak every field and workflow on day one. But over-customization can lead to complexity and confusion.

Solution: Start with the basics. Use the CRM’s default settings for the first few weeks, then gradually add custom fields and automations as you identify real needs.

How CRM Software for Small Business Improves Customer Experience

At its best, CRM software isn’t just a tool for sales teams—it’s a customer experience engine. Here’s how it transforms the way you engage with clients.

1. Personalized Communication

With a CRM, you know your customers’ history. You can reference past purchases, preferences, and pain points in every interaction.

For example, a small e-commerce store can use CRM data to send personalized product recommendations based on browsing behavior—increasing conversion rates and customer loyalty.

2. Faster Response Times

When a customer reaches out, your team can instantly pull up their profile, see previous conversations, and respond appropriately—without asking, “What was this about again?”

This level of service builds trust and makes customers feel valued.

3. Proactive Support

CRMs with helpdesk features allow you to track support tickets and set up automated responses. You can also identify at-risk customers (e.g., those with unresolved issues) and reach out before they churn.

For instance, a SaaS startup can use CRM alerts to check in with users who haven’t logged in for 30 days, offering help or onboarding resources.

Future Trends in CRM Software for Small Business

The CRM landscape is evolving fast. Small businesses that stay ahead of trends can gain a competitive edge. Here are the key developments to watch.

1. AI and Predictive Analytics

AI is no longer just for big corporations. Modern CRMs like Zoho and Freshsales use AI to predict which leads are most likely to convert, suggest optimal follow-up times, and even draft email responses.

In the near future, AI-powered CRMs will act as virtual sales assistants, handling routine tasks and providing real-time coaching.

2. Voice-Activated CRM

With the rise of smart speakers and voice assistants, voice-enabled CRM features are gaining traction. Sales reps can update records, log calls, and retrieve data using voice commands—ideal for hands-free environments.

Zia Voice by Zoho and Salesforce’s Einstein Voice are early examples of this trend.

3. Hyper-Personalization

Customers expect personalized experiences. Next-gen CRMs will leverage behavioral data, purchase history, and even sentiment analysis to deliver hyper-relevant content and offers.

For small businesses, this means being able to compete with giants by offering a human touch at scale.

What is the best CRM software for small business?

The best CRM software for small business depends on your specific needs. HubSpot CRM is ideal for those wanting a powerful free option, while Zoho CRM offers deep customization. For sales-focused teams, Pipedrive excels with its visual pipeline. Evaluate your goals, team size, and budget before deciding.

Is CRM software worth it for small businesses?

Yes, CRM software is absolutely worth it for small businesses. It improves customer retention, increases sales efficiency, and reduces administrative workload. With ROI averaging $8.71 for every $1 spent, it’s one of the most cost-effective tools available.

Can I use CRM software for free?

Yes, several CRM platforms offer free plans. HubSpot CRM and Agile CRM have robust free versions suitable for small teams. These include contact management, email tracking, and basic automation—perfect for startups and solopreneurs.

How long does it take to implement a CRM?

Implementation time varies. Simple CRMs like HubSpot can be set up in under an hour. More complex systems may take a few weeks, especially if you’re migrating large amounts of data or customizing workflows. Most vendors offer onboarding support to speed up the process.

Do I need technical skills to use CRM software?

No, most modern CRM software for small business is designed to be user-friendly. Platforms like HubSpot, Pipedrive, and Freshsales require no coding or technical expertise. They offer drag-and-drop interfaces, pre-built templates, and extensive help centers.

Choosing the right CRM software for small business is one of the smartest decisions you can make. It streamlines operations, enhances customer relationships, and sets the foundation for scalable growth. Whether you opt for a free tool like HubSpot or invest in a feature-rich platform like Zoho, the key is to start—consistently use the system, train your team, and let data drive your decisions. In today’s customer-centric world, a CRM isn’t just a tool—it’s your business’s memory, your sales coach, and your customer’s best friend.


Further Reading:

Back to top button